Cuprins
Pentru oricine se ocupă cu programarea, un laptop adecvat este mai mult decât un simplu instrument – este o extensie a minții creative, un partener în rezolvarea problemelor și o poartă către noi descoperiri și realizări. Așa cum un pictor se bazează pe pensula sa pentru a aduce la viață capodopere, și un programator are nevoie de un laptop performant pentru a codifica, testa și implementa soluții eficiente.
Dar ce înseamnă “cel mai bun laptop pentru programare”? Răspunsul nu este nici universal, nici static. Depinde de o multitudine de factori, inclusiv limbajul de programare utilizat, proiectele la care lucrezi, bugetul tău și, nu în ultimul rând, preferințele și obiceiurile tale personale. Poate însemna un laptop cu un procesor de ultimă generație, o cantitate masivă de memorie sau o baterie care poate rezista o zi întreagă.
În acest articol, vom explora aceste variabile și vom discuta despre modul în care ele influențează alegerea unui laptop de programare. Vom trece prin diferite specificații tehnice, vom aborda importanța portabilității și confortului, și vom învăța cum să adaptăm alegerea la nevoile noastre specifice. Scopul nostru este de a te ajuta să alegi laptopul de programare care va fi cel mai bine adaptat cerințelor tale, pentru a-ți maximiza productivitatea și a-ți îmbunătăți experiența de programare.
De ce un laptop special pentru programare?
Un laptop de programare nu este doar un dispozitiv obișnuit. Echipat cu componente de înaltă performanță, acesta este proiectat să facă față sarcinilor complexe, de la scrierea liniei de cod, la testarea și rularea programelor. Astfel, un laptop de programare nu doar că îți permite să te ocupi de task-uri avansate, dar și să îți optimizezi procesul de lucru.
Să ne gândim la proiectele pe care un programator le poate avea. Acestea pot varia de la dezvoltarea de aplicații mobile, la crearea de jocuri complexe, până la manipularea de seturi mari de date sau la proiecte de machine learning. Toate aceste sarcini necesită un nivel ridicat de putere de procesare, de memorie și de stocare. Un laptop obișnuit s-ar putea să nu poată face față acestor solicitări, încetinindu-te sau chiar împiedicându-te să-ți finalizezi proiectele.
Un alt aspect care face un laptop de programare special este capacitatea sa de a se adapta la nevoile tale. Programatorii tind să petreacă mult timp în fața ecranului. Prin urmare, calitatea ecranului, confortul tastaturii și ergonomia generală sunt elemente esențiale care pot influența experiența ta de lucru. Un laptop de programare este proiectat cu aceste cerințe în minte, oferindu-ți un mediu de lucru mai confortabil și mai eficient.
În plus, pentru un programator, laptopul este adesea principalul instrument de lucru. Un laptop de programare durabil și fiabil nu este doar o investiție în productivitate, dar și în pacea minții tale. Nu vrei să te îngrijorezi că laptopul tău s-ar putea defecta în mijlocul unui proiect important.
Deci, în timp ce un laptop de programare poate părea la prima vedere similar cu alte laptopuri, specificațiile sale interne, capacitatea de adaptare și durabilitatea îl fac să se distingă. În cele din urmă, alegerea unui laptop de programare este o decizie strategică care poate îmbunătăți calitatea muncii tale și poate duce la o carieră mai reușită.
Specificațiile tehnice esențiale
Laptopul tău de programare trebuie să fie capabil să gestioneze sarcini multiple și să ruleze software-uri solicitante. Acest lucru înseamnă că trebuie să aibă un procesor puternic, suficientă memorie RAM și o unitate de stocare suficient de mare și rapidă.
În primul rând, procesorul (CPU) este creierul laptopului tău. Un CPU puternic poate accelera compilarea codului, transformând task-urile care durează minute în unele care durează doar secunde. În cazul în care lucrezi cu aplicații de machine learning sau procesezi seturi de date mari, un procesor de ultimă generație, cum ar fi Intel i7 sau i9, sau echivalentul lor AMD, ar putea fi esențial.
Memoria RAM, pe de altă parte, este spațiul de lucru al laptopului tău. Ea stochează datele temporare de care procesorul are nevoie pentru a rula aplicațiile în timp real. Cu cât ai mai multă memorie RAM, cu atât poți rula mai multe aplicații simultan, fără a încetini performanța. În general, un laptop de programare ar trebui să aibă cel puțin 8 GB de RAM, deși 16 GB sau mai mult ar fi ideal pentru a lucra în mod confortabil cu mai multe aplicații și tab-uri deschise simultan.
În ceea ce privește stocarea, un disc solid-state (SSD) este de preferat unui hard disk drive (HDD) tradițional. SSD-urile sunt semnificativ mai rapide decât HDD-urile, ceea ce înseamnă că laptopul tău va rula mai fluid, va încărca fișierele mai rapid și va reduce timpul de încărcare atunci când pornești laptopul sau deschizi programele. În funcție de cantitatea de cod pe care o scrii și de dimensiunea proiectelor tale, ai putea avea nevoie de un SSD cu o capacitate de cel puțin 256 GB sau 512 GB.
În final, nu uita de placa grafică. Deși majoritatea programărilor nu necesită o putere grafică uriașă, dacă lucrezi în dezvoltare de jocuri, grafică 3D sau procesare de imagini, o placă grafică puternică poate fi esențială.
Înțelegerea acestor specificații tehnice esențiale te poate ajuta să îți alegi laptopul de programare potrivit, asigurându-te că are puterea și performanța de care ai nevoie pentru a-ți face munca eficient și plăcut.
Portabilitatea și confortul
Unul dintre avantajele unui laptop de programare este posibilitatea de a lucra de oriunde. Verifică greutatea și dimensiunea laptopului, durata de viață a bateriei și calitatea tastaturii pentru a te asigura că îți va oferi confortul de care ai nevoie în timpul sesiunilor lungi de codare.
Portabilitatea este un factor important pentru programatori, mai ales dacă lucrezi în mod regulat în afara biroului sau călătorești des. Un laptop mai ușor și mai compact este mai ușor de transportat, dar asigură-te că nu sacrifici performanța pentru portabilitate. O dimensiunea a ecranului de 13-15 inci este adesea un echilibru bun între vizibilitate și portabilitate.
Durata de viață a bateriei este, de asemenea, crucială pentru portabilitate. Un laptop cu o durată de viață lungă a bateriei îți permite să lucrezi ore întregi fără a fi legat de o priză. Caută un laptop care oferă cel puțin 6-8 ore de utilizare la o încărcare, deși cu cât mai mult, cu atât mai bine.
În ceea ce privește confortul, tastatura este probabil cel mai important aspect pentru un programator. Va trebui să tastezi cod pentru ore în șir, deci ai nevoie de o tastatură confortabilă, cu butoane responsive și un layout care îți place. Unele tastaturi au și iluminare de fundal, care poate fi utilă atunci când lucrezi în condiții de iluminare slabă.
De asemenea, nu uita de calitatea ecranului. O rezoluție mai mare îți permite să vezi mai mult cod deodată și să ai mai multe ferestre deschise simultan. Un ecran cu o rată de refresh ridicată și un unghi de vizualizare larg poate reduce și oboseala ochilor în timpul sesiunilor lungi de programare.
În final, ia în considerare și zgomotul și căldura generate de laptop. Un laptop care devine prea cald sau face prea mult zgomot sub sarcină poate deveni deranjant în timp.
Așadar, în timp ce specificațiile tehnice sunt vitale pentru alegerea unui laptop de programare, nu uita de importanța portabilității și a confortului. Un laptop confortabil și ușor de transportat îți poate îmbunătăți semnificativ experiența de lucru, permițându-ți să fii productiv indiferent unde te afli.
Adaptabilitatea la nevoile specifice
În funcție de limbajul de programare utilizat sau de domeniul tău de activitate (dezvoltare web, jocuri, inteligență artificială etc.), s-ar putea să ai nevoie de anumite caracteristici specifice. De exemplu, pentru dezvoltarea de jocuri, o placă video bună ar fi esențială.
Pentru dezvoltarea web, viteza și eficiența sunt adesea prioritare, deci un procesor puternic și o cantitate generoasă de RAM sunt esențiale. Dacă lucrezi cu limbaje de programare care necesită compilare, cum ar fi Java sau C++, un CPU rapid poate reduce semnificativ timpul de compilare. De asemenea, dezvoltatorii web pot beneficia de un ecran mai mare sau chiar de un setup cu ecrane multiple pentru a gestiona eficient codul, browserul și alte instrumente.
În cazul în care lucrezi în dezvoltarea de jocuri, o placă video puternică devine esențială. Dezvoltarea de jocuri necesită adesea randarea 3D în timp real și lucrul cu motoare de jocuri grafic-intensive, deci un GPU capabil este un must. De asemenea, pentru dezvoltarea de jocuri, o cantitate mai mare de stocare poate fi utilă, deoarece proiectele de jocuri pot fi destul de voluminoase.
Dacă domeniul tău de lucru este legat de inteligența artificială sau machine learning, ai putea avea nevoie de specificații și mai puternice. Algoritmi de machine learning pot necesita o cantitate semnificativă de putere de procesare și memorie pentru a antrena modelele, iar un GPU puternic poate accelera semnificativ acest proces.
În plus, pentru orice tip de programare, un număr suficient de porturi (USB, HDMI, etc.) poate fi util pentru conectarea de dispozitive externe, precum monitoare suplimentare, tastaturi, mouse-uri sau dispozitive de stocare. De asemenea, dacă preferi un anumit sistem de operare, asigură-te că laptopul ales suportă și funcționează bine cu acesta.
Prin urmare, atunci când alegi un laptop de programare, este important să îți evaluezi nevoile specifice și să te asiguri că laptopul ales se poate adapta la acestea. Un laptop care se potrivește perfect nevoilor tale te poate ajuta nu doar să fii mai productiv, dar și să te bucuri mai mult de munca ta.
Importanța sistemului de operare în programare
Sistemul de operare al laptopului tău de programare joacă un rol esențial în activitatea ta. În funcție de limbajul de programare pe care îl utilizezi, de proiectele la care lucrezi sau de preferințele tale personale, un anumit sistem de operare poate fi mai potrivit decât altele.
De exemplu, dacă ești un dezvoltator iOS sau lucrezi cu Swift, macOS va fi cel mai probabil alegerea ta, deoarece Apple susține dezvoltarea nativă pe propriul său sistem de operare. În plus, macOS vine cu un set de unelte de dezvoltare încorporate, precum Terminal și Xcode, care sunt foarte apreciate de către dezvoltatori.
Dacă lucrezi cu .NET, C# sau alte tehnologii Microsoft, Windows ar putea fi sistemul de operare cel mai potrivit pentru tine. Windows este, de asemenea, popular pentru dezvoltarea de jocuri, cu suport larg pentru diverse motoare de jocuri.
Linux, pe de altă parte, este deseori alegerea favorită a programatorilor și a dezvoltatorilor de software datorită flexibilității și controlului pe care îl oferă. Linux este un sistem de operare open-source, ceea ce înseamnă că îți poți personaliza în detaliu experiența. De asemenea, multe instrumente de programare și limbaje, precum Python sau Ruby, funcționează excelent pe Linux.
Într-un final, alegerea sistemului de operare ar trebui să se bazeze pe nevoile și preferințele tale. Este important să te asiguri că laptopul pe care îl alegi este compatibil și se comportă bine cu sistemul de operare preferat. Cu toate acestea, mulți programatori aleg să ruleze mai multe sisteme de operare folosind virtualizarea, pentru a avea flexibilitate maximă.
Strategii pentru menținerea performanței unui laptop pentru programare
Odată ce ai investit într-un laptop de programare potrivit, este esențial să îți asiguri că își menține performanțele în timp. Iată câteva sfaturi despre cum poți să îți păstrezi laptopul de programare în cea mai bună formă.
- Gestionează-ți spațiul de stocare: Asigură-te că ai suficient spațiu liber pe discul tău dur pentru a evita încetinirea sistemului. Folosește unelte de curățare a discului și șterge periodic fișierele inutile sau temporare. De asemenea, este o idee bună să ai un sistem de organizare a fișierelor tale pentru a găsi rapid ceea ce ai nevoie.
- Actualizează-ți software-ul: Menține-ți sistemul de operare și aplicațiile actualizate. Actualizările aduc adesea îmbunătățiri de performanță, corecții de erori și patch-uri de securitate care pot ajuta laptopul să funcționeze mai bine și mai în siguranță.
- Menține-l fizic curat: Un laptop curat este un laptop fericit. Asigură-te că ții laptopul departe de praf și murdărie. De asemenea, este important să cureți periodic tastatura și ecranul, și să te asiguri că sistemul de răcire al laptopului nu este blocat de praf.
- Gestionează-ți resursele: Învață cum să monitorizezi și să gestionezi utilizarea resurselor pe laptopul tău. Unele aplicații sau procese pot consuma o cantitate mare de resurse, încetinind restul sistemului. Învață cum să identifici aceste “devoratoare de resurse” și să le gestionezi corespunzător.
- Fă backup-uri regulate: Un backup al datelor tale este esențial. Acest lucru îți poate salva zile de muncă în cazul unei erori de sistem sau a unei defecțiuni hardware. Există numeroase soluții de backup, de la discuri externe la servicii de stocare în cloud.
Prin urmărire a acestor sfaturi, poți menține laptopul de programare în cea mai bună formă, asigurându-ți că îți servește nevoile de programare pentru un timp îndelungat.
Concluzie
În concluzie, alegerea unui laptop pentru programare implică o analiză atentă a nevoilor tale și a specificațiilor disponibile pe piață. Un laptop de programare bine ales va fi nu doar un instrument puternic, ci și un aliat în demersurile tale creative și profesionale.
Este esențial să iei în considerare factori precum procesorul, memoria RAM, stocarea și placa video, dar să nu neglijezi nici aspecte precum portabilitatea, confortul și adaptabilitatea la nevoile tale specifice. Nu există un “cel mai bun laptop pentru programare” valabil pentru toată lumea – cel mai bun laptop pentru tine va depinde de cerințele specifice ale muncii tale, de bugetul tău și de preferințele tale personale.
În timp ce alegerea unui laptop de programare poate părea o sarcină copleșitoare, investiția într-un laptop care se potrivește cu stilul tău de lucru și nevoile tale te poate ajuta să devii mai eficient, mai confortabil și, în cele din urmă, mai fericit în munca ta. Deci, când faci această investiție, gândește-te la ea ca la o investiție în succesul tău ca programator.
În ultimă instanță, alegerea unui laptop pentru programare este un echilibru între performanță, portabilitate, confort și preț. Cu o cercetare atentă și o înțelegere clară a nevoilor tale, poți găsi laptopul perfect pentru a te ajuta să îți atingi obiectivele în domeniul programării.